Introduction

An F5 Certified BIG-IP Administrator can handle application delivery networks (ADNs) and F5 Traffic Management Operating System (TMOS) devices, as well as conduct routine management and troubleshooting. The F5-CA qualification requires passing two exams:

  • Exam 101-Fundamentals of Application Delivery
  • Exam 301a-TMOS Administration

Pre-existing BIG-IP implementations and provisional fault isolation are managed by an F5 Certified BIG-IP Administrator. They must be able to edit BIG-IP artefacts and make appropriate configuration adjustments. They’re still in charge of application delivery networks (ADNs) and managing and troubleshooting F5 Traffic Management Operating System (TMOS) devices on a regular basis. These Certified Experts manage BIG-IP infrastructure such as virtual servers, pools, pool owners, nodes, accounts, and displays using TMSH and a setup utility. They also maintain BIG-IP repositories and build, rebuild, and manage them. Certified BIG-IP Administrators must therefore review the state, functionality, and statistics of a resource in order to consider how BIG-IP networks are actually handling traffic.

The function of BIG-IP systems as a proxy mechanism inside an ADN is defined by administrators. BIG-IP devices are set up, licensed, and provisioned by them. Profiles are used by a Certified BIG-IP Administrator to monitor how BIG-IP networks handle traffic across virtual servers. They’re also in need of utilizing different medical methods to troubleshoot and diagnose issues. After it has been mounted, configured, and applied, passing this exam demonstrates independence in conducting day-to-day operations and simple troubleshooting of TMOS-based systems in different application environments. Individuals may opt to finish their credential path here or go on to the Technical Professional, Technical Specialist, Cloud, or Security Solutions tracks.
